LunaTranslator全场景安装指南:从入门到精通的效率提升方案
【免费下载链接】LunaTranslatorGalgame翻译器,支持HOOK、OCR、剪贴板等。Visual Novel Translator , support HOOK / OCR / clipboard项目地址: https://gitcode.com/GitHub_Trending/lu/LunaTranslator
还在为Galgame语言障碍困扰?想流畅体验多语言视觉小说却被复杂配置劝退?LunaTranslator作为一款专为视觉小说爱好者设计的翻译工具,集成HOOK(实时文本捕获)、OCR(图像文字识别)和剪贴板翻译等多重功能,让你轻松突破语言壁垒。本文将通过四阶架构,帮助你从功能认知到实际应用,全方位掌握这款工具的安装配置技巧。
功能价值:为什么选择LunaTranslator
LunaTranslator通过三大核心能力提升你的游戏体验:
- 实时文本捕获:通过HOOK技术直接获取游戏内文字,无需手动输入
- 多引擎翻译:集成百度、谷歌、DeepL等主流翻译服务,支持在线/离线模式
- 智能OCR识别:应对图像化文字场景,精准提取游戏画面中的文本内容
环境预检:确保安装顺畅的准备工作
在开始安装前,建议先完成以下环境检查,避免常见兼容性问题:
- 操作系统:推荐Windows 10/11 64位版本(Windows 7需额外安装KB2999226补丁)
- 硬件配置:至少4GB内存,OCR功能建议配备独立显卡提升识别速度
- 软件依赖:已安装Python 3.8+(推荐3.9版本)及pip包管理工具
[!TIP] 安装前建议暂时关闭杀毒软件,部分安全软件可能误报HOOK组件为恶意程序
分步实施:高效安装配置流程
获取项目源码
建议通过Git工具克隆项目仓库,便于后续更新:
# 适用场景:首次安装或需要获取最新开发版本 git clone https://gitcode.com/GitHub_Trending/lu/LunaTranslatorⓘ 若没有Git环境,也可直接下载项目压缩包并解压到任意非中文路径
依赖安装优化
进入项目目录后,使用pip安装依赖包。针对网络问题,提供两种安装方案:
# 适用场景:网络通畅时的标准安装 pip install -r requirements.txt # 适用场景:国内网络环境,使用清华大学镜像源 pip install -r requirements.txt -i https://pypi.tuna.tsinghua.edu.cn/simpleⓘ 依赖安装失败时,可尝试单独安装报错的包,如pip install package_name --upgrade
基础配置初始化
首次运行前,建议通过配置文件进行基础设置:
{ "default_translator": "google", "ocr_engine": "tesseract", "hook_delay": 200, "translation_cache": true, "cache_size": 500 }ⓘ 配置文件路径:src/LunaTranslator/defaultconfig/config.json
场景应用:定制化配置方案
典型配置方案对比表
| 应用场景 | 推荐配置 | 优势 | 资源占用 |
|---|---|---|---|
| 低配电脑 | Tesseract OCR + 百度翻译 | 轻量高效,离线可用 | 低(<500MB内存) |
| 网络环境好 | 腾讯OCR + DeepL翻译 | 识别精准,翻译质量高 | 中(1-2GB内存) |
| 专业玩家 | 多引擎组合 + 自定义词典 | 灵活应对复杂场景 | 高(2GB+内存) |
常见问题解决方案
问题1:HOOK功能无法捕获游戏文本
- 解决方案:1. 以管理员身份运行程序 2. 检查游戏是否为32位/64位对应版本 3. 尝试不同的HOOK引擎(位于src/LunaTranslator/textio/textsource/texthook.py)
问题2:OCR识别准确率低
- 解决方案:1. 更新Tesseract语言包 2. 调整游戏分辨率至1080p以上 3. 在设置中增加识别区域对比度
问题3:翻译接口频繁失效
- 解决方案:1. 检查API密钥有效性 2. 切换备用翻译引擎 3. 配置代理服务器(位于src/LunaTranslator/myutils/proxy.py)
高级功能探索
完成基础配置后,可尝试这些进阶功能提升体验:
- 自定义词典:通过src/LunaTranslator/cishu/目录下的词典文件添加专业术语
- 文本后处理:在src/LunaTranslator/transoptimi/中配置文本过滤规则
- 快捷键设置:修改src/LunaTranslator/gui/setting/hotkey.py定义操作热键
[!TIP] 定期执行
git pull更新项目,可获取最新功能和bug修复
通过本文档的指导,你已经掌握了LunaTranslator的安装配置方法。这款工具不仅能帮助你突破语言障碍,更能通过灵活的配置满足不同场景需求,让每一款视觉小说都能带来最佳体验。现在就启动程序,开启你的无障碍游戏之旅吧!
【免费下载链接】LunaTranslatorGalgame翻译器,支持HOOK、OCR、剪贴板等。Visual Novel Translator , support HOOK / OCR / clipboard项目地址: https://gitcode.com/GitHub_Trending/lu/LunaTranslator
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考